Decision 2012/392/CFSP is amended as follows:
(1)
in Article 3, paragraph 4 is replaced and a new paragraph is added, as follows:
‘4. EUCAP Sahel Niger shall develop and implement, in close coordination with the Union’s delegation in Niamey, a communication strategy to foster EU values and promote EU action in the Sahel, in particular in Niger.
5. EUCAP Sahel Niger shall not carry-out any executive function.’;
(2)
in Article 13(1), the following subparagraph is added:
‘The financial reference amount to cover the expenditure related to EUCAP Sahel Niger for the period from 1 October 2022 to 30 September 2024 shall be EUR 72 161 381,16.’;
(3)
in Article 14, the following paragraph is added:
‘4. The Head of Mission shall cooperate with other CSDP Missions, in particular with EUCAP Sahel Mali, including the Regional Advisory and Coordination Cell, and with EUBAM Libya.’;
(4)
in Article 15, paragraph 4 is replaced, and a new paragraph is added, as follows:
‘4. The High Representative shall be authorised to release to the Union Justice and Home Affairs agencies, in particular to Frontex and Europol, EU classified information generated for the purposes of EUCAP Sahel Niger up to the relevant level of classification respectively for each of them, in accordance with Decision 2013/488/EU. Technical arrangements shall be drawn up for that purpose.
5. The High Representative may delegate the powers referred to in paragraphs 1 to 4, as well as the ability to conclude the arrangements referred to in paragraphs 2 and 4, to persons placed under his/her authority, to the Civilian Operation Commander and/or to the Head of Mission.’;
(5)
in Article 16, the second sentence is replaced by the following:
‘It shall apply until 30 September 2024.’.
